With all of this week's snowfall, Elkhart City Officials are taking the time to remind residents to keep city sidewalks safe.
A city ordinance requires all homeowners to take the proper actions to clear sidewalks of snow. Homeowners have 24 hours to get the sidewalks near their property cleaned.
Failure to do so could result in a $25 fine each time the sidewalks go uncleared. City officials say this rule is not to punish homeowners, but to promote public safety.
If anyone is unable to comply with the ordinance, they are asked to contact the Building and Code Enforcement Department for a hardship exception.
